WebJul 12, 2024 · Obesity has been linked to menstrual irregularities, chronic anovulation, PCOS, glucose intolerance, infertility, and pregnancy complications. Increased serum androgen, insulin, and estrogen levels, and lower concentrations of sex hormone-binding globulin (SHBG) are also prevalent.
